Sorry is my fault, cfengine can handle this (Always read the doc ;-) ).
there is an option:
   action=bymatch

That is exactly what i wanted. Only one thing. If a specify this option
and i run cfagent verbose. It looks like it is signalling the process but
is not, because the check of how many matches is later.

cfengine:arrakis: Signalling process 35426 (cfexecd) with SIGKILL

I personally think that this message must not be displayed if
action=bymatch is specified:

process.c (version 2.0.4)

function FindMatches:

  snprintf(OUTPUT,bufsize*2,"Signalling process %d (%s) with 
%s\n",pid,pp->expr,SIGNALS[pp->signal]);
  CfLog(cfinform,OUTPUT,"");

 must be replaced by:

 if (pp->action != 'm')
    {
    snprintf(OUTPUT,bufsize*2,"Signalling process %d (%s) with 
%s\n",pid,pp->expr,SIGNALS[pp->signal]);
    CfLog(cfinform,OUTPUT,"");
    }

> I am now using filters for processes. I want to track down some daemons and 
> make sure that only one runs ( or a specified number). If there are more then 
> one process or less. It must kill the processes and start daemon. 
> I use the following code:
> 
> control:
> 
>   IfElapsed = ( 0 )
>   actionsequence = ( processes )
> 
> processes:
>   "cfexecd"
>      filter=daemons matches=1 action=do signal=kill
>      restart "/etc/init.d/cfexecd restart"
> 
> filters:
>   { daemons
>     PPID: "[ ]+1"
>     Result: "PPID"
>   }
> 
> 
> This code will always kill the 'cfexecd'-daemon and then restart it. What i
> expected was that it will only kill the process if the number of processes
> does not match with 'matches' option. Is this a bug, misconfiguration or 
> intended?
